 90 GTI V-6 build thread (yes V-6 NOT VR6)« »

hey all. i thought it was time i introduced my car and the build.
it's a 90 VW GTI with a corrado g-60 brake upgrade. car originaly came with a 16v 2.0 wich was swapped for a g-60 drivetrain. that drivetrain was sold so back in went the 16v. got tired of how slow it was and started looking for swap ideas.....and looking...found the usual vr swaps along with the turbo swap but still wasnt convinced. thought about making it rear wheel drive..to much time and money. then a bud told me about the vw they stuffed a northstar engine into and that got me thinking..(hardly ever happens)i did my homework and found out the northstar does'nt have much aftermarket stuff i could use in the vw.started looking elsewere.my brther bought himself a pontiac GTP and brought it over for me to test drive. all i can say is TORQUE.. that thing pulls like a raped ape..alarms bell wistles started going off (in my head). the search began. engine /tranny/wiring harness were procured from a wrecked GTP and the swap began.. to all my friends/haters who said it couldnt be done.."kiss my glow in the dark white harry ass"

 Re: FV-QR (MikkiJayne) »« »

two front mounts are oem GM. The two back ones are home made. Sorry no pics of those yet. As for cv joints. Wheel side will be VW the rest will be gtp. I plan on milling them on a lathe till they fit then weld them togeter. If that doesn't work then I'll have them custom made.
